The tea export market is thriving, with growing demand for high-quality beverages across the globe. B2B suppliers play a crucial role in meeting this demand, offering a diverse range of products from various tea-growing regions.
Recent market research indicates a significant increase in tea consumption worldwide. Health consciousness, relaxation needs, and the rise of gourmet teas are just a few drivers. Understanding these factors can help suppliers position themselves strategically.
Establishing trust and credibility is essential in the B2B export environment. Attend trade fairs, join online platforms, and leverage social media to connect with potential buyers.
In today’s digital age, a strong online presence is vital. Wholesale markets are increasingly shifting to e-commerce platforms where suppliers can showcase their unique offerings, making it easier to reach global clients.
Ensuring the highest quality of tea products is paramount. Implementing rigorous quality control processes at every stage of production can help export suppliers maintain a competitive edge.
In conclusion, the tea export industry holds immense potential for B2B suppliers. By understanding market dynamics, nurturing relationships, and focusing on quality, suppliers can thrive in this competitive landscape.
